FAQ
Does heavier arrow weight always raise kinetic energy?
Not always. KE depends on both mass and speed, so very large speed losses can offset mass gains.
How should I use this output?
Use it for directional comparisons, then confirm speed and impact behavior with real equipment testing.
Should I prioritize KE, momentum, or FOC?
Use all three together to balance efficiency, penetration context, and flight stability.
